Flood, Thomas (no replies)

$
0
0
Jan. 27, 1881. Thomas Flood, trackman on LS & WS RR Co, was struck by Train #83 (J. W. Babcock conductor, George Hartlerode engineer), 1 and 1/2 mile east of Reno. Both legs broken, head injured, hurt internally, died about 15 hours after accident. Coroner's verdict: Death not due to negligence of engineer or parties in charge of train. /S/ A. W. Cox, coroner. "The section men left this handcar across the NY P & O track from the Lake Shore track, the engineer states that the injured man was across the NY P & O. track, apparently went to get something for their car and tried to return and was struck." /S/ J. W. Babcock, conductor. Report sent 2/1/81. Venango County.

(Source: Record of Accidents, 1865-1887 on the Atlantic and Great Western Railroad, Crawford, Mercer and Venango Counties, Pa.)
